Abstract :
Rotational sensorless control methods are one of the motor control methods with high performance and high reliability. One of the technical issued with the rotational speed sensorless controlled AC motors is to re-start their operation when inverters stop and the rotor speed or angle estimation. There several method to cope with the problems and they are reviewed in this paper.
